Paylaşım Project Zomboid Sunucu Kurulumu | Adım Adım Topluluğa

Durum
Üzgünüz bu konu cevaplar için kapatılmıştır...

KorayA

Somon Balığı Selam Vermeye Geldi
Katılım
9 Mart 2023
Mesajlar
24
Elmaslar
5
Puan
3.750
Konum
İstanbul
Discord İzni
Minecraft
Ko_RAY

Discord:

koray_a

Selamlar, hayatta kalanlar!

Birçoğumuz Zomboid'i arkadaşlarla oynamanın ne kadar keyifli olduğunu biliyoruz. Peki, kendi dünyanızın kurallarını belirlediğiniz, modlarla zenginleştirdiğiniz ve 7/24 açık kalan bir sunucu kurmaya ne dersiniz? "Çok karmaşık" diye düşünmeyin! Bu rehberde, hem en basit yöntem olan Steam "Host" seçeneğini hem de tam kontrol sağlayan "Dedicated Sunucu" kurulumunu adım adım anlatacağım.



Başlamadan Önce: Gerekenler



  1. Project Zomboid Oyunu: Sunucuyu kuracak kişinin Steam'de oyuna sahip olması gerekir.
  2. Yeterli Bir Bilgisayar: Sunucu, özellikle oyuncu ve mod sayısı arttıkça RAM kullanır. En az 8 GB RAM'e sahip bir bilgisayar önerilir. Sunucunun kendisi için en az 2-4 GB RAM ayırmanız gerekecek.
  3. Stabil İnternet Bağlantısı: Özellikle yüksek upload (yükleme) hızı, oyuncuların gecikme (lag) olmadan oynaması için kritiktir.



Yöntem 1: En Kolay ve Hızlı Yol (Steam "HOST" Seçeneği)



Bu yöntem, sadece arkadaşlarınızla oynamak istediğinizde ve sunucunun sadece siz oyundayken aktif olmasının sorun olmadığı durumlar için idealdir. Teknik bilgi gerektirmez.

  1. Oyunun ana menüsünden "HOST" seçeneğine tıklayın.
  2. "Sunucu Ayarlarını Yönet..." butonuna basın ve yeni bir ayar profili oluşturun. Örneğin, ismine "Arkadaşlar" deyin.
  3. Sunucu Belleği (RAM): En önemli adım burası. Oynayacak kişi sayısına göre RAM ayırmanız gerekir. Genel bir kural olarak:
    • 2-4 oyuncu için: 4096MB (4GB)
    • 5-8 oyuncu için: 6144MB (6GB) veya 8192MB (8GB)
  4. Ayarları düzenleme ekranında (INI sekmesi) sunucunuzun temel kurallarını belirleyin: Oyuncu sayısı, PvP durumu, güvenli evler vb.
  5. Ayarları kaydedip geri dönün ve oluşturduğunuz profili seçerek "BAŞLAT" deyin.
  6. Sunucu açıldığında, arkadaşlarınızı Steam arayüzü üzerinden (Shift+Tab > Arkadaş Listesi > Sağ Tık > Oyuna Davet Et) davet edebilirsiniz.
Artıları: Çok kolay ve hızlı.Eksileri: Siz oyundan çıktığınızda sunucu kapanır. Kalabalık gruplar ve çok sayıda mod için performansı düşebilir.




Yöntem 2: Tam Kontrol ve 7/24 Sunucu (Dedicated Sunucu)



Bu yöntem biraz daha teknik olsa da sunucu üzerinde size tam kontrol sağlar ve siz oyunda olmasanız bile açık kalır.



Adım 1: Sunucu Dosyalarını Çalıştırma



  1. Steam kütüphanenizden Project Zomboid'e sağ tıklayın > Yönet > Yerel dosyalara göz at.
  2. Açılan klasörde ProjectZomboidServer.bat dosyasını bulun ve çalıştırın.
  3. Bir komut istemi (siyah ekran) açılacak ve sizden bir admin şifresi belirlemenizi isteyecektir. Şifrenizi yazın, Enter'a basın ve tekrar yazarak onaylayın.
  4. Bu işlemden sonra sunucu dosyaları oluşturulacak ve komut istemi kapanacaktır.


Adım 2: RAM Ayarını Yapılandırma



Bu, sunucunuzun performansı için en kritik adımdır.

  1. ProjectZomboidServer.bat dosyasına sağ tıklayın ve "Düzenle" seçeneğini seçin.
  2. İçindeki metin şu şekilde görünecektir:
    "%~dp0jre64\bin\java.exe" -Xms16g -Xmx16g ...
  1. Buradaki -Xms16g ve -Xmx16g değerleri sunucunun kullanacağı minimum ve maksimum RAM miktarını belirtir. g gigabyte demektir. Bu değerleri kendi sisteminize ve oyuncu sayınıza göre düzenleyin.
    • Örnek 4GB RAM için: -Xms4g -Xmx4g
    • Örnek 8GB RAM için: -Xms8g -Xmx8g
  2. Değişikliği yapıp dosyayı kaydedin.


Adım 3: Sunucu Ayarlarını Yapma (.ini Dosyası)



  1. C:\Kullanıcılar\SENİN_KULLANICI_ADIN\Zomboid\Server klasörüne gidin.
  2. Burada servertest.ini adında bir dosya göreceksiniz. Bu dosya, sunucunuzun tüm ayarlarını içerir. Not defteri ile açın.
  3. Önemli ayarlar:
    • PublicName=: Sunucunuzun listede görünecek adı.
    • PublicDescription=: Sunucu açıklaması.
    • Password=: Oyuncuların sunucuya girmek için kullanacağı şifre (boş bırakırsanız şifresiz olur).
    • MaxPlayers=: Maksimum oyuncu sayısı.
    • Mods=: Sunucuya eklenecek modların ID'leri.
    • WorkshopItems=: Sunucuya eklenecek modların Workshop ID'leri.


Adım 4: Port Yönlendirme (Port Forwarding)



Arkadaşlarınızın internet üzerinden size bağlanabilmesi için modeminizde port açmanız gerekir. Bu adım atlanırsa kimse sunucunuza katılamaz!

  1. Project Zomboid şu portları kullanır:
    • 16261 (UDP)
    • 16262 (TCP)
  2. Modeminizin arayüzüne girin (genellikle 192.168.1.1 veya 192.168.0.1).
  3. "Port Yönlendirme", "NAT" veya "Sanal Sunucu" gibi bir bölüm bulun.
  4. Yukarıda belirtilen portları, sunucuyu kurduğunuz bilgisayarın yerel IP adresine yönlendirin. (Yerel IP'nizi öğrenmek için CMD'ye ipconfig yazabilirsiniz).


Adım 5: Sunucuya Mod Ekleme



  1. Steam Atölyesi'nden istediğiniz modlara abone olun.
  2. Modun Atölye sayfasında, açıklama kısmında Mod ID ve Atölye ID (Workshop ID) yazar.
  3. servertest.ini dosyasını açın:
    • Mods= satırına, modların Mod ID'lerini aralarında noktalı virgül (;) ile yazın.
    • WorkshopItems= satırına, modların Atölye ID'lerini aralarında noktalı virgül (;) ile yazın.
    • Örnek: Mods=ModAdı1;ModAdı2 ve WorkshopItems=12345;67890


Adım 6: Sunucuyu Başlatma ve Bağlanma



  1. Tüm ayarları yaptıktan sonra ProjectZomboidServer.bat dosyasını tekrar çalıştırın. Sunucu başarıyla açılacaktır.
  2. Arkadaşlarınız oyundaki "KATIL" (JOIN) menüsünden sunucunuzu adı ile aratarak veya onlara vereceğiniz Public IP adresiniz ve port (örn: 85.105.XX.XX:16261) ile doğrudan bağlanabilirler. (Public IP adresinizi öğrenmek için Google'a "what is my ip" yazabilirsiniz).

Umarım bu rehber kendi Zomboid dünyanızı yaratmanızda yardımcı olur. Unutmayın, ilk kurulum biraz deneme yanılma gerektirebilir. Takıldığınız yerde sormaktan çekinmeyin!

Bol şans ve ısırılmamaya dikkat edin! :D
 
Durum
Üzgünüz bu konu cevaplar için kapatılmıştır...

Hala Discord sunucumuza katılmadın mı?

Büyük bir topluluğun parçası ol, etkinliklere katıl ve özel hediyeler kazanma şansı yakala!

Şimdi Katıl
Üst